SC issues notice, allows EC to continue with electoral roll revision in Bihar

New Delhi, 10/7: The Supreme Court on Thursday allowed the Election Commission of India to continue with its Special Intensive Revision (SIR) of electoral rolls in Bihar calling it a “constitutional mandate”. Vijay Deverakonda, Rana Daggubati, Prakash Raj among 29 actors, influencers, YouTubers booked by ED in online-betting-linked PMLA case

Hyderabad: The Enforcement Directorate has filed a money laundering case to look into the role of more than two dozen celebrities, including actors like Vijay Deverakonda, Rana Daggubati and Prakash Raj, apart from some social media influencers and YouTubers in Telengana. RCB disputes tribunal’s remarks that its social media posts drew crowds to Chinnaswamy Stadium during stampede

Bengaluru: Royal Challengers Sports Private Limited (RCSPL), which owns the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) IPC team, has moved the Karnataka High Court, challenging certain observations made in a Central Administrative Tribunal (CAT) order. Namibia to launch UPI as PM Modi’s visit sees four bilateral agreements signed

Windhoek: Namibia will roll out the Unified Payments Interface (UPI) later this year, it was announced on Wednesday following talks between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Namibian President Netumbo Nandi-Ndaitwah that focused on imparting a new momentum to the bilateral series.
